Rumour: Call Of Duty Online Reveal Nears


UPDATE: Our informants tell us it's some kind of stats tool. BORING!

Something's happening in Call Of Duty world! Our sinister agents have picked up some information about Activision preparing to make a major announcement regarding the Call Of Duty franchise, and it sounds like the PC could be at the heart of it: Call Of Duty Online. We understand that the "online solution" Activision have been hinting at might finally be ready to be shown to press. No other details now, but I'm going to speculate that this is Activision's big move against EA's Battlefield Play4Free and the like.

Will it be a browser-based shooter? A free-to-play MMO? A side-scrolling beat 'em up? We'll find out soon!
